| Notes | Mounted with F.124.1-2. These two fragments appear to be from the same manuscript which was probably a monastic choir book (such as a Gradual or an Antiphonal). These would have originally been part of the Central School's Teaching Examples Collection. | |
| Object Notes | Foliate border decoration with stylised tri-lobed flowers, berries and gold dots; red guide-lines or staves are visible. This is a fragment of a decorative border (in purple, green and gold) which would originally have surrounded a body of text, a miniature or a body of musical notation and text. The recto (and only side of this fragment visible) shows that this side of the parchment was the 'hair' side. | |
